Land cl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, stumps, and other vegetation to prepare a property for development, landscaping, or other projects. These services often include grading, debris removal, and earthmoving to create a clean, level site suited for construction or aesthetic enhancements. Professionals utilize specialized equipment such as bulldozers, excavators, and mulching machines to efficiently clear large areas, ensuring that the land is properly prepared for its intended use.

This service helps address common problems such as overgrown vegetation, invasive plants, and uneven terrain that can hinder construction or landscaping efforts. Excessive brush and trees can obstruct views, limit access, or pose safety hazards. Clearing a property can also improve drainage, reduce pest habitats, and create a safer environment for future development or outdoor activities. Proper land clearing can prevent issues related to soil erosion and facilitate the installation of utilities or infrastructure.

Properties that typically utilize land clearing services include residential lots, commercial sites, agricultural land, and recreational areas. Residential properties may need clearing before building new homes, garages, or outdoor amenities. Commercial developments often require extensive clearing to prepare for parking lots, retail spaces, or industrial facilities. Agricultural lands might undergo clearing to expand crop fields or pastureland, while parks and recreational spaces are cleared to establish open areas for public use or sports fields.

The overview below groups typical Land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Montgomery County, PA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per Acre Costs - Land clearing typically ranges from $1,200 to $3,500 per acre, depending on tree density and terrain. For example, clearing a half-acre lot may cost between $600 and $1,750. Variations depend on site size and complexity.

Per Square Foot Pricing - Smaller projects often cost between $0.10 and $0.50 per square foot. Clearing a 10,000-square-foot yard might therefore fall between $1,000 and $5,000. Costs fluctuate based on vegetation and access difficulty.

Tree Removal Fees - Removing large trees can cost from $500 to over $2,000 per tree, influenced by size and species. Smaller trees generally cost less, while hazardous or hard-to-reach trees may increase expenses.

Additional Costs - Land clearing may include expenses for debris removal, stump grinding, or grading, which can add $500 to $3,000 or more. These costs depend on the scope of work and site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
